In "Refill" (2019), Rebecca Ness constructs a quietly charged domestic moment through the precise, matte luminosity that gouache on paper uniquely affords. Measuring an intimate 19.1 by 16.5 centimetres, the work rewards close attention, its small scale pulling the viewer into a world rendered with both economy and psychological weight. Ness deploys the medium's characteristic opacity to build flat, saturated fields of colour that sit in careful tension with one another, lending the composition a graphic clarity that feels at once playful and deeply considered. Ness has developed a singular visual language in which everyday scenes become strange through subtle distortions of scale, perspective, and figural presence. Her figures are recognisable yet slightly removed from naturalism, occupying spaces that feel familiar but charged with an unnamed undercurrent. "Refill" exemplifies this sensibility, finding something both mundane and quietly absurd in a gesture or moment of replenishment, a word that itself carries implications of depletion, ritual, and continuation. Works on paper by Ness occupy a particularly compelling place within her practice, offering a directness and intimacy distinct from her larger canvases.
